Alcoholism takes a significant toll on both physical and mental health, leading to various medical complications and an increased risk of mortality. Studies indicate that liver cirrhosis and cancers are among the leading causes of death in alcoholics, reducing their life expectancy by 10 to 12 years. Alcohol dependence has been identified as the third leading cause of preventable morbidity and mortality in the United States. Furthermore, these individuals also show higher mortality rates from all causes of death, including diseases, medical conditions, and suicide.

Alcoholism is the primary cause of all cirrhosis cases, and as many as 20% of chronic alcohol abusers will develop this fatal condition. Though most people do not consider hangovers to be a serious effect of alcoholism, they do have several adverse health effects. During a hangover, the person is at greater risk for cardiac arrhythmias, depression, hormonal imbalances, as well as impaired brain and liver function. In addition to these health concerns, a person with a hangover might not perform well at work.
